Introduction to CSS3 Course

Introduction to CSS3 Course Course

Introduction to CSS3 offers a clear, project-based path to mastering core CSS concepts. Beginners will appreciate the step-by-step approach and accessibility focus, while more experienced learners can...

Explore This Course
9.7/10 Highly Recommended

Introduction to CSS3 Course on Coursera — Introduction to CSS3 offers a clear, project-based path to mastering core CSS concepts. Beginners will appreciate the step-by-step approach and accessibility focus, while more experienced learners can reinforce best practices and debugging techniques.

Pros

  • High learner satisfaction with a 4.8/5 rating from over 9,600 reviews.
  • Hands-on assignments using real HTML templates.
  • Strong emphasis on accessibility with POUR guidelines.

Cons

  • Fast-paced for absolute novices; some prior HTML familiarity helps.
  • Limited coverage of modern layout systems like Flexbox and Grid.

Introduction to CSS3 Course Course

Platform: Coursera

What will you learn in Introduction to CSS3 Course

  • Understand the importance of separating content from presentation in web pages.
  • Write basic CSS rules to modify colors, fonts, and text properties.
  • Manipulate layout and spacing using the box model, width, height, and line-height.

​​​​​​​​​​

  • Apply advanced selectors, pseudo-classes, and pseudo-elements for dynamic styling.
  • Ensure accessibility by evaluating pages with POUR guidelines.

Program Overview

Module 1: Getting Started with Simple Styling
⌛ ~4 hours

  • Topics: Course welcome, CSS syntax, selectors, color properties, font styling.
  • Hands-on: Write CSS rules to style headings, paragraphs, and links on a sample HTML page.

Module 2: Box Model, Layout, and Typography
⌛ ~4 hours

  • Topics: Box model fundamentals (margin, border, padding), width/height, text properties, line-height.
  • Hands-on: Adjust layout and text appearance on an existing page using box-model properties.

Module 3: Advanced Selectors and Dynamic Effects
⌛ ~4 hours

  • Topics: Attribute selectors, pseudo-classes (hover, focus), pseudo-elements (::before, ::after), transitions.
  • Hands-on: Add hover effects and smooth transitions to navigation menus and buttons.

Module 4: Responsive Design and Accessibility
⌛ ~4 hours

  • Topics: Media queries basics, browser compatibility, POUR accessibility guidelines.
  • Hands-on: Implement a responsive layout and evaluate it for accessibility compliance.

Module 5: Capstone Project – Complete CSS Page
⌛ ~4 hours

  • Topics: Integrating CSS concepts, debugging best practices, maintainability strategies.
  • Hands-on: Sketch a design for a provided HTML template and use CSS to fully realize the mockup.

Get certificate

Job Outlook

  • Strong demand for front-end developers and web designers with solid CSS skills.
  • Roles such as Front-End Developer, UI/UX Designer, and Web Accessibility Specialist rely on CSS3 expertise.
  • Mastery of responsive design and accessibility increases employability across tech companies and agencies.

Explore More Learning Paths
Enhance your web design skills and create visually appealing, responsive websites with these carefully selected courses focused on CSS, HTML, and front-end development.

Related Courses

Related Reading

  • What Is Management? – Explore the key concepts of web development and the essential skills needed to build modern websites and applications.

FAQs

Will I gain skills in advanced CSS selectors, pseudo-classes, and transitions?
Covers attribute selectors, pseudo-classes like hover and focus, and pseudo-elements (::before, ::after). Teaches adding smooth transitions and dynamic effects. Includes exercises to enhance navigation menus and buttons. Prepares learners for creating interactive and visually engaging web pages. Skills directly transferable to professional front-end development projects.
How long will it take to complete the course and practice CSS exercises?
Duration: approximately 20 hours, divided into five 4-hour modules. Self-paced learning allows flexible scheduling. Modules cover simple styling, box model, advanced selectors, responsiveness, and a capstone project. Hands-on exercises reinforce every concept progressively. Suitable for learners seeking structured and immersive CSS3 training.
Can I learn responsive design and web accessibility skills?
Teaches media queries for responsive layouts. Covers browser compatibility and accessibility using POUR guidelines. Includes exercises to evaluate and adjust pages for accessibility. Skills improve employability as a front-end or UI/UX developer. Prepares learners to create inclusive and mobile-friendly web pages.
Will I learn to style text, colors, and page layouts effectively?
Covers font styling, text properties, and color rules. Teaches layout adjustments using the box model, width, height, and spacing. Includes exercises to style headings, paragraphs, and links. Focuses on improving readability and visual appeal. Prepares learners for creating visually polished web pages.
Do I need prior HTML knowledge to take this CSS3 course?
Some prior HTML familiarity recommended but not strictly required. Focuses on styling, layout, and accessible web design. Includes hands-on exercises with sample HTML templates. Ideal for beginners aiming to become front-end developers or web designers. Teaches core CSS3 concepts step-by-step for practical application.

Similar Courses

Other courses in Computer Science Courses